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Lack of documentation? #295

Closed
ghost opened this issue Apr 29, 2015 · 1 comment
Closed

Lack of documentation? #295

ghost opened this issue Apr 29, 2015 · 1 comment

Comments

@ghost
Copy link

ghost commented Apr 29, 2015

I apologize in advance. I'm a bit frustrated and that comes out below. I'm trying to tone it down.

This is a request for more complete documentation.

For having such widespread use and acclaim, I was surprised at holes in the documentation for this tool.

Some examples:

You give an abbreviated list of two options, --clean and --verbose, for the librarian-puppet install command, but don't describe what --clean means. Running librarian-puppet help install lists a whole bunch of options without saying what any of them mean.

You have a whole long section on "Configuration" and only end up describing two configuration options, path and tmp. Are there only two configuration options for the entire system? Also, the description for the path configuration option talks about "cookbooks". What are cookbooks? That's the first and only time that "cookbooks" ever mentioned in the entire document.

There's other places where the documentation only makes sense if you already know what it's talking about. For example, the only reference to the metadata directive is a backwards reference to a previous description of the default behavior in the absence of a Puppetfile. My first few times reading this document, I completely missed that back-reference and kept looking for the section that would explain what the metadata directive did.

@carlossg
Copy link
Collaborator

carlossg commented May 1, 2015

I have fixed a couple of things in the readme, a PR with improved docs would always be welcome

@carlossg carlossg closed this as completed May 6, 2015
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ant